About The Position

The Facilities and Support Services Director is responsible for the development and implementation of a District program of maintenance and construction services. The Director shall ensure the physical school plant is in excellent operation in order that full educational use of it may be made at all times. The Director supervises the transportation coordinator, maintenance, construction within the District and consults with head custodians and principals.

Responsibilities

  • Cooperates with the Assistant Superintendent in the coordination of new construction for the District
  • Plans and supervises major alteration projects
  • Recommends priorities on repair projects
  • Maintains compliance with all local, state and federal mandatory inspections, i.e. smoke detectors, sprinkler systems, fire panel, fire extinguishers, fire hydrants, pull stations, state fire inspections, kitchen Ansul systems, backflow, playground, structural, environmental quality, health department, and CO2
  • Estimates costs of repair projects in terms of labor, material, and overhead
  • Prepares or obtains specifications needed for outside contracts, alterations, and maintenance projects
  • Examines school buildings quarterly for needed repairs and maintenance
  • Assigns, supervises and inspects maintenance work
  • Develops a system for dealing with emergency repair problems with efficiency
  • Prepares reports on work done, materials used, and labor expended
  • Sees that materials are available when needed by coordinating purchasing of supplies and maintenance equipment in accordance with mandated procurement codes
  • Establishes preventive maintenance programs for school plants
  • Makes periodic reports to the Assistant Superintendent on progress of construction, alteration projects, and maintenance programs
  • Evaluates school maintenance programs and makes recommendations for efficiency and cost improvements
  • Calls and conducts meetings of the head custodians, when deemed necessary, for the purposes of training
  • Establishes and supervises summer maintenance and cleaning programs and schedules
  • Assumes the responsibilities as the Districts’ Emergency Incident Commander
  • Provides all training to District Administration regarding evacuation and relocation emergency procedures
  • Establishes and maintains a District safety committee
  • Establishes District standards for safety compliance with all federal, state, and local regulations
  • Makes periodic safety and fire inspections of all District properties and initiates corrective action for all potential or realized hazards
  • Provides support to Transportation Department regarding emergencies, accidents and personnel shortage
  • Completes and submits mandatory reporting claims to the TRUST regarding vehicles, buildings & outdoor facilities
